casa
$Rev:20696$
|
#include <CTMainColInterface.h>
Public Member Functions | |
CTMainColInterface () | |
CTMainColInterface (const Table &ctAsTable) | |
virtual | ~CTMainColInterface () |
virtual void | init (const Table &ctAsTable) |
virtual const ROArrayColumn < Bool > & | flag () |
virtual const Bool | flagRow (const Int &i) |
virtual const ROScalarQuantColumn< Double > & | exposureQuant () |
For now, return timeEPQuant() even for exposureQuant. | |
virtual const ROScalarQuantColumn< Double > & | timeQuant () |
virtual const MeasurementSet * | asMS () |
This is not an MS. | |
Private Attributes | |
NewCalTable | ct_p |
ROCTMainColumns * | ctCols_p |
Definition at line 49 of file CTMainColInterface.h.
casa::CTMainColInterface::CTMainColInterface | ( | ) | [inline] |
Definition at line 52 of file CTMainColInterface.h.
casa::CTMainColInterface::CTMainColInterface | ( | const Table & | ctAsTable | ) | [inline] |
Definition at line 53 of file CTMainColInterface.h.
References init().
virtual casa::CTMainColInterface::~CTMainColInterface | ( | ) | [inline, virtual] |
Definition at line 56 of file CTMainColInterface.h.
References ctCols_p.
virtual const MeasurementSet* casa::CTMainColInterface::asMS | ( | ) | [inline, virtual] |
This is not an MS.
Implements casa::MSSelectableMainColumn.
Definition at line 70 of file CTMainColInterface.h.
virtual const ROScalarQuantColumn<Double>& casa::CTMainColInterface::exposureQuant | ( | ) | [inline, virtual] |
For now, return timeEPQuant() even for exposureQuant.
Implements casa::MSSelectableMainColumn.
Definition at line 66 of file CTMainColInterface.h.
References ctCols_p, and casa::ROCTMainColumns::timeEPQuant().
virtual const ROArrayColumn<Bool>& casa::CTMainColInterface::flag | ( | ) | [inline, virtual] |
Implements casa::MSSelectableMainColumn.
Definition at line 61 of file CTMainColInterface.h.
References ctCols_p, and casa::ROCTMainColumns::flag().
virtual const Bool casa::CTMainColInterface::flagRow | ( | const Int & | i | ) | [inline, virtual] |
Implements casa::MSSelectableMainColumn.
Definition at line 63 of file CTMainColInterface.h.
References ctCols_p, and casa::ROCTMainColumns::flag().
virtual void casa::CTMainColInterface::init | ( | const Table & | ctAsTable | ) | [inline, virtual] |
Reimplemented from casa::MSSelectableMainColumn.
Definition at line 58 of file CTMainColInterface.h.
References ct_p, and ctCols_p.
Referenced by CTMainColInterface().
virtual const ROScalarQuantColumn<Double>& casa::CTMainColInterface::timeQuant | ( | ) | [inline, virtual] |
Implements casa::MSSelectableMainColumn.
Definition at line 67 of file CTMainColInterface.h.
References ctCols_p, and casa::ROCTMainColumns::timeQuant().
NewCalTable casa::CTMainColInterface::ct_p [private] |
Definition at line 70 of file CTMainColInterface.h.
Referenced by init().
Definition at line 73 of file CTMainColInterface.h.
Referenced by exposureQuant(), flag(), flagRow(), init(), timeQuant(), and ~CTMainColInterface().